A stand-alone educational system designed to provide hands-on experience with fuel cell performance and efficiency testing. It enables students and trainees to explore the core principles of fuel cell technology, observe real-time data, and understand the various factors influencing fuel cell operation, such as temperature, load, humidity, and gas flow rates. Through a range of experiments, this trainer demonstrates the efficiency, power output, durability, and operational characteristics of a fuel cell under different conditions, making it an ideal tool for learning about alternative energy technologies.
- This trainer provides a comprehensive educational experience, equipping trainees with theoretical knowledge and practical skills crucial for understanding and working with fuel cell technologies in sustainable energy applications.
- The trainer includes a PEM fuel cell, voltage and current meters, temperature sensors, gas flow meters, humidity control, exhaust analyzer, variable load, and data logging interface.
- The PEM fuel cell converts hydrogen and oxygen into electricity, water, and heat.
- Voltage and current meters monitor output in real-time for performance analysis.
- Temperature sensors track the cell temperature, showing its effect on efficiency.
- Gas flow meters measure and control hydrogen and oxygen input rates.

- Humidity control adjusts moisture levels to study its effect on fuel cell output.
- The exhaust analyzer assesses exhaust composition for efficiency evaluation.
- The variable load allows testing under different power loads for performance insights.
- The trainer features a real-time digital display and data logging capability.
- Safety features include an emergency stop button, gas sensors, and pressure relief valves.
